King James Version (KJV)
Moreover also I gave them my sabbaths, to be a sign between me and them, that they might know that I am the LORD that sanctify them.
American Standard Version (ASV)
Moreover also I gave them my sabbaths, to be a sign between me and them, that they might know that I am Jehovah that sanctifieth them.
Bible in Basic English (BBE)
And further, I gave them my Sabbaths, to be a sign between me and them, so that it might be clear that I, who make them holy, am the Lord.
Darby English Bible (DBY)
And I also gave them my sabbaths, to be a sign between me and them, that they might know that I [am] Jehovah that hallow them.
World English Bible (WEB)
Moreover also I gave them my Sabbaths, to be a sign between me and them, that they might know that I am Yahweh who sanctifies them.
Young’s Literal Translation (YLT)
And also My sabbaths I have given to them, To be for a sign between Me and them, To know that I `am’ Jehovah their sanctifier.
